RAID mode 7 , stores the information by spreading it over several data discs with one or more parity disks. The method involves 7 card microprocessor running a real-time kernel that controls all operations of SCSI host channels and disks, the parity calculation, cache management and disk monitoring. All transfers are asynchronous which increased from 1.5 to 6 times the write performance compared to other RAID levels. This mode supports the loss of multiple disks on the number of parity disks assigned, and also theoretically can support 12 channels and 48 hosts connected disks. Most RAID 7 controllers can be configured and managed on an Ethernet connection through an SNMP agent.
